What is A4 Copier Paper?
A4 paper belongs to the ISO 216 requirement, which defines the sizes of paper utilized in many countries worldwide. The measurements of A4 paper are 210 mm × 297 mm (8.27 in × 11.69 in). This size is commonly utilized for documents, letters, reports, and other printed materials. A4 paper is commonly accepted in the corporate sector, educational organizations, and homes.
Specs of A4 Copier Paper
To comprehend the qualities of A4 photo copier paper, let us delve into its specs:
| Specification | Description |
|---|---|
| Dimensions | 210 mm × 297 mm |
| Weight | Generally 80 gsm (grams per square meter) |
| Brightness | Measured by ISO brightness (greater worths suggest much better quality) |
| Finish | Smooth or textured, depending on the planned use |
| Opacity | The degree to which light go through the paper |
The weight of the paper, which is typically measured in grams per square meter (gsm), significantly impacts its quality and toughness. A4 paper is commonly offered in weights ranging from 70 gsm to 300 gsm.

Aspects to Consider When Buying A4 Copier Paper
Purchasing A4 photo copier paper might seem straightforward, however there are several factors to consider to ensure you are making the best option for your needs:
Weight: As discussed above, the weight of the paper impacts its thickness and resilience. Consider what type of documents you will be printing. For everyday prints, standard paper might be sufficient, while discussions may require a heavier stock.
Brightness: The brightness of the paper can affect the quality of the printed output. Higher brightness levels (generally above 90) result in sharper images and text.
End up: Decide whether you require a smooth or textured surface based upon the last application of the printed material. Smooth paper is better for premium prints, while textured paper might add an expert touch to imaginative tasks.
Ecological Impact: If sustainability is a concern for you or your organization, think about opting for recycled or sustainably sourced paper.

Cost: Prices can vary considerably based on type and quality. Balancing your budget with your quality requirements will assist you in making the ideal decision.
